Pericardial Effusion/Cardiac Tampanode and Pleural Effusion

 
1.5 Content Hours $19

Who Should Be Interested:
Nurses or any clinical personnel working with patients experiencing a cancer diagnosis.

Behavioral/Learning Objectives:

  1. Recognize signs and symptoms of Pericardial Effusion/Cardiac Tamponade and Pleural Effusion.
  2. Identify nursing assessment and diagnostic procedures for Pericardial Effusion/Cardiac Tamponade and Pleural Effusion.
  3. Describe treatment and nursing care associated with Pericardial Effusion/Cardiac Tamponade and Pleural Effusion.
